The Jayapura City Ecodefender Community together with a number of Cenderawasih University lecturers and students voluntarily held learning activities with children aged Kindergarten, Elementary School, Junior High School to High School in Enggros Village, Abepura District, Jayapura City, Papua Province, Saturday (15/15) 4/2023).
This learning activity covers letter recognition for Kindergarten age children, making vegetable seeds for Primary School age children, as well as learning to type on the computer for Middle School and Senior High School age children.
Apart from that, the volunteers also gave children an understanding of the importance of protecting the sea and forests around Enggros Village from plastic waste by behaving in an environmentally friendly manner.
Head of Jayapura City Ecodefender Community, Nelce Assem said, this activity was carried out in Enggros Village, because this village is located on a conservation area site. The need for an understanding of the environment from an early age, so that later when they become youths and adults, they are able to protect their territory from various threats.
This village is located in the Youtefa Bay Natural Tourism Park area which is in the Yos Sudarso Bay area which was stipulated by Decree of the Minister of Agriculture Number 372/kpts/Um/6/1978 dated 9 June 1978.
In 1996 the legal status of the Youtefa Bay area was strengthened by the issuance of the Decree of the Minister of Forestry of the Republic of Indonesia Number 714/kpts/1996 dated 11 November 1996 concerning the Designation of the Youtefa Bay Area as a Conservation Area with Designation as a Natural Tourism Park covering an area of ​​1,657 hectares.
Youtefa Bay Tourism Park is flanked by two headlands jutting from the left side, namely Cape Pie and Cape Saweri which are on the right side separated by a small strait about 300 meters wide which is called the Tobati Strait and is also the entrance and exit of Youtefa Bay from the sea. (Yos Sudarso Bay).
Youtefa Bay Tourism Park includes flat to undulating lowlands with an altitude range of 0-73 meters above sea level. Apart from that, there are mangrove/mangrove forests and in several other parts there are mountainous areas and also sago forests that stand on the sidelines of the mountains.
Kampung Injros has an area of ​​33.37 ha, with administrative boundaries, namely: to the north it is bordered by Tobati Village; to the south it is bordered by Abepantai sub-district, to the west by Waimhorock sub-district and to the east by Holtekamp Village.
